Product Definition

A Duffel Form, Re-Engineered for Wet and Unpredictable Conditions

A waterproof duffel bag combines the loading convenience of a traditional travel duffel with a coated shell and protected seam construction. The format is useful when users need a large opening, high carrying capacity and fewer water-entry points than a conventional stitched fabric bag.

The phrase waterproof duffle bag is often used interchangeably with waterproof duffel bag. In either case, buyers should separate three different performance levels: weather protection, temporary water exposure and tested submersion. The correct claim depends on the completed bag rather than the fabric alone.

Closure Selection

Choose the Opening by Protection Target—not Appearance Alone

Leading waterproof-duffel designs use either roll-top or specialized zipper systems. Each route has a different balance of access, cost, maintenance and claim potential.

Rugged & simple

Roll-Top Duffel

A broad opening is folded and secured to create a practical barrier against rain, splash and wet transport conditions.

  • Useful for marine, rafting and expedition programs
  • Adjustable packed volume
  • Fewer complex closure components
Fast-access technical route

Waterproof Zipper Duffel

A purpose-selected zipper can support quick access and a cleaner duffel profile when integrated with welded construction.

  • Suitable for premium gear and travel products
  • Requires zipper care and closure discipline
  • Any immersion claim requires finished-bag testing
Travel-focused protection

Protected Zipper Duffel

A coated shell and shielded zipper offer weather protection for travel, gym, motorcycle and equipment storage applications.

  • Convenient wide opening
  • Useful organization and pocket options
  • Should not be described as submersible without testing
Capacity Planning

Select Volume by Trip Length, Load Shape and Carry Method

Capacity is only a starting point. Pattern dimensions, opening size, roll allowance, reinforced panels and airline limits must be reviewed together.

Development Range Typical Use Suggested Construction Direction Useful Details Buyer Consideration
30–40L Gym, day trip, beach, compact motorcycle luggage, short travel Light TPU, coated textile or compact PVC structure Removable strap, external handle, small accessory pocket Confirm actual airline rules before making carry-on claims.
50–70L Weekend travel, paddling, fishing, dive gear, general expedition use TPU or abrasion-oriented PVC shell with reinforced base Backpack straps, compression webbing, ID panel, lash points Balance access width with seam strength and packed shape.
80–100L+ Marine equipment, rescue kits, wet suits, team gear, commercial field use Heavy-duty PVC or project-specific TPU with webbing cradle Multiple handles, reinforced bottom, high-load hardware Strap anchoring and load testing become primary design factors.
These ranges are development references rather than fixed product specifications. Final capacity, dimensions, weight and waterproof wording should be approved after physical sampling and testing.
PVC vs TPU

Two Material Routes for Different Product Positions

DERFLEX develops waterproof-bag programs from its coated-textile base. The material decision should reflect the target selling price, feel, load, climate and expected wear.

Durable commercial direction

PVC Waterproof Duffel Bag

PVC coated polyester is commonly considered for robust gear duffels, marine storage and value-focused product programs where structure and abrasion resistance are priorities.

  • Practical balance of durability and production cost
  • Broad color, gloss, matte and embossed surface options
  • Often evaluated for HF or hot-air welding
  • Useful for reinforced bottoms and high-wear zones
Premium flexible direction

TPU Waterproof Duffel Bag

TPU coated nylon or polyester is considered for lighter, softer and more technical duffel programs, including cold-weather, premium outdoor and refined travel products.

  • Flexible hand feel and lower-weight options
  • Useful cold-folding performance depending on formulation
  • Clean matte, glossy or textile-backed appearance
  • Hot-air, ultrasonic or HF welding may be evaluated

Verification

Test the Finished Duffel Against the Claim You Plan to Make

Fabric waterproofness does not automatically prove that a complete bag is waterproof. Openings, seam intersections, handle anchors and hardware can change the result.

DERFLEX coated fabric production and roll goods factory
Water Ingress Test

Match the method to rain, spray, temporary immersion or another defined exposure condition.

Seam Strength

Review peel strength, weld consistency and vulnerable intersections after repeated flexing.

Strap Load Test

Test handles, shoulder straps, backpack anchors and hardware at the intended packed weight.

Abrasion Review

Check base panels, corners, webbing contact zones and surfaces likely to drag or rub.

Closure Cycling

Repeat rolling, buckling or zipper operation to evaluate usability and performance consistency.

Visual Standard

Confirm color, print, logo placement, surface finish, dimensions and packaging against approval.

Climate Consideration

Where relevant, review cold folding, heat exposure, UV ageing or saltwater contact.

Responsible Claims

Use “IPX7,” “IPX8,” “submersible” or depth claims only after the completed bag passes the applicable test.

What makes a duffel bag genuinely waterproof?

A waterproof shell is only the first requirement. The seam construction, closure, zipper ends, handle anchors, valve points and accessory attachments must also prevent water entry. The completed bag should be tested against the intended claim.

Is a roll-top waterproof duffel bag submersible?

Not automatically. A correctly closed roll-top can be effective against rain, splash and short accidental water contact, but prolonged immersion may allow water to enter through the opening. A submersible claim requires a suitable closure and finished-product testing.

Should I choose PVC or TPU for my waterproof duffel?

PVC coated polyester is often considered for durable, structured and cost-controlled duffel programs. TPU coated nylon or polyester is selected when lower weight, flexibility, cold performance or premium surface feel is more important. The best route depends on your product brief and sample results.

Can the duffel be carried as a backpack?

Yes, convertible layouts can include removable or fixed backpack straps, grab handles and shoulder-carry options. Strap anchoring, padding and load distribution should be tested at the intended packed weight.

Which logo and branding options are available?

Depending on material and surface finish, projects may consider screen printing, heat transfer, welded or sewn patches, embossed details, printed panels, woven labels, ID windows and customized retail packaging. A physical sample is recommended for approval.
